外部 ERP システムを使用した倉庫管理専用モード
この記事では、倉庫モードを使用して外部企業リソース計画 (ERP) システムと統合する場合に、倉庫管理に関する毎日のタスクを実行する方法について説明します。
重要
- これはプレビュー機能です。
- プレビュー機能は、運用上の用途のためのものではなく、機能が制限されている場合があります。 これらの機能には、追加使用条件 が適用され、顧客が早期にアクセスしてフィードバックを提供できるよう、公式リリースより前に使用できます。
さまざまな方法で使用できます ( モードのみ)。 たとえば、物流 Microsoft Dynamics 365 Supply Chain Management を有効にした後接続注文と財務処理を行う外部ERPシステムに倉庫を保管することができます。
さらに、倉庫管理プロセスでは、所有者在庫分析コードを使用して、ソース システム間で共有される品目の在庫の所有権を追跡できます。
高レベル実装の例
次の図は、
受信プロセスの例 (外部ERPシステム統合)
次の図は、入庫プロセスの要素を強調表示しています。
受信プロセスの高レベルの説明を次に示します。 ERPシステムによって ERP 開始完了手順を実行できます。 最初に開始する 、倉庫 モード完了管理サプライ チェーンから開始されます。
ERP : 外部システムは、会社の管理に着信出荷注文メッセージサプライ チェーンします。
[高い サプライ チェーン管理] : 倉庫管理モードでのみメッセージが処理され、注文が作成されます。
高い
入庫負荷は、次のいずれかの方法で作成されます。受信負荷は、 ソース システム 設定によって設定されます。サプライ チェーン方法があります。- 手動、入庫積荷計画ワークベンチを使用
- 出荷の詳細通知 (ASN) インポート
- メッセージ処理中 に自動的に
- 倉庫管理モバイル アプリの受取プロセス中に自動で
WORKERM : 作業者は、倉庫管理モバイル アプリケーションを使用して 登録 出荷トランザクションを行います。
LOADM : サプライ チェーンの実行 ファイルの完了 関連する各負荷に関連するプロセスです。 これらのプロセスでは、負荷ステータスを Received、生成 在庫入庫、および トリガー ビジネス イベント 外部システムに対して更新します。
ERP : 外部システムは、追加処理のためにサービス入庫 データ を読み取って使用します。 たとえば、発注書が外部システムの入庫オーダーに関連付けられている場合、この処理には発注書請求が含まれます。
[高い サプライ チェーン、出荷入庫の転記 バッチ ジョブを実行して、受信した出荷注文を。
このプロセスおよび関連プロセスの詳細については、「 管理での倉庫管理のみモードを使用した作業」をサプライ チェーンしてください。
出荷プロセスの例 (外部ERPシステム統合)
次の図は、出庫プロセスの要素を強調表示しています。
次に、出荷プロセスの高レベルの説明を示します。 ERPシステムによって ERP 開始完了手順を実行できます。 最初に開始する 、倉庫 モード完了管理サプライ チェーンから開始されます。
ERP : 外部システムが出荷注文メッセージを送信します。
[高い サプライ チェーン管理] : 倉庫管理モードでのみメッセージが処理され、注文が作成されます。
拡張子 : Inventory reservationは、企業管理における ソース システム 設定) として、次のいずれかの方法でサプライ チェーンされます。
- メッセージ プロセッサ で自動的に
- リリース プロセスの一環として手動で
面上: 注文は、さらに倉庫処理のために手動または自動 (出荷出荷注文のリリース 出荷注文の自動リリースバッチ ジョブ) にリリースされます。
WORKM : テンプレート サイクル 定義の設定で、倉庫作業が即座に作成およびリリースされる場合があります。
[高い 出庫倉庫] 作業が処理され、関連する出荷注文品目トランザクションのステータスが "ピッキング済" に更新 されます。
[拘束] : 負荷は出荷確認済です。 その結果、外部 に対して および 明細の梱包明細 ビジネス イベントが作成されます。
ERP : 外部システムは、出荷梱包明細を読み取り、そのデータをさらに処理するために使用します (出荷出荷注文に関連付けられている販売注文の請求など)。
[高い サプライ チェーン、出荷梱包明細の転記 バッチ ジョブを実行して出荷出荷を確定します。
このプロセスおよび関連プロセスの詳細については、「 管理での倉庫管理のみモードを使用した作業」をサプライ チェーンしてください。
システム間の手持在庫の更新
次の図は、倉庫管理専用モードで使用される内部プロセスを示しています。
倉庫管理モジュールでは、在庫棚卸仕訳帳 複数の 在庫更新プロセスをサポートしています。 棚卸プロセスに関する詳細については、循環棚卸 を参照してください。
仕訳帳転記プロセスの一環として、サプライ チェーンビジネス イベントがトリガされます。 外部システムは、更新に関する情報を 仕訳帳エンティティを使用して読み取。 更新された数量だけを処理することが重要です。 更新されていない場合は、更新によってシステムが同期しから移動できます。 以下に例としてのシナリオを示します。
シナリオ例: システム間での手持在庫の更新
このシナリオが開始すると、次の表に示すように、品目番号A0001に関する入庫情報が外部ERPシステム (ERP) と サプライ チェーン 管理倉庫管理システム (WMS) の間で同期しています。
品目番号 | ERP 手持在庫 | WMS 手持在庫 |
---|---|---|
A0001 | 0 個 | 0 個 |
次のサブセクションでは、さまざまなイベントによってこれらの値がどのように変化するかを示します。
手持在庫の更新 1
サプライ チェーンA0001を実行せずに、受信した出荷注文に対して10個の品目番号A0001を受け取ります。 完了および されません。 したがって、外部システムにはこの更新についてまだ通知されていません。 その結果、次の表に示すようにサプライ チェーン外部のシステムとグループのManagementは同期しています。
品目番号 | ERP 手持在庫 | WMS 手持在庫 |
---|---|---|
A0001 | 0 個 | 10 個 |
手持在庫の更新 2
[サプライ チェーンa001] で、品目A0001に対して転記される在庫調整 (棚卸仕訳帳) によって、1個の在庫が追加されます。 次の表に、この結果を示します。
品目番号 | ERP 手持在庫 | WMS 手持在庫 |
---|---|---|
A0001 | 0 個 | 11 個 |
外部システムには、ビジネス イベントを通じて手持調整について通知されます。 このプロセスの一環として、Supply Chain Management での仕訳転記が 10 個から 11 個に変更されます。 外部システムでは、更新された数量 1 個のみが考慮されます。 次の表に、この結果を示します。
品目番号 | ERP 手持在庫 | WMS 手持在庫 |
---|---|---|
A0001 | 1 個 | 11 個 |
手持在庫の更新 3
Supply Chain Management は、受け取った品目番号 A0001 の 10 個に関連する 受取完了 プロセスを実行します。 したがって、外部システムにはビジネス イベントを通じて通知されます。 次に、出荷受領情報を読み取り、手持数量を追加の 10 個で更新します。 次の表に、この結果を示します。
品目番号 | ERP 手持在庫 | WMS 手持在庫 |
---|---|---|
A0001 | 11 個 | 11 個 |
ノート
それぞれの品目が、"1つ以上のモデル" または "参照データ" の説明で構成された品目モデル に割り当てられている。 この方法で、仕訳帳を使用して調整を行う 既定の転記 および 既定のカレンダー を使用して調整を行う場合 します。
手持在庫の調整
倉庫管理のみモードでは、ソース システムの在庫の調整プロセスに対してデータを生成できます ( ソース システムの在庫の作成 レポート在庫管理>在庫調整>物理在庫調整>ソース システムの在庫レポートの作成)。
ヘッダーと行データを作成するには、ソース システム と 現在の日付 の値を指定する必要があります。 レポートを生成する在庫分析コードのレベルも選択する必要があります。
入庫する出荷注文に関連する在庫を受け取った場合、登録済の在庫トランザクションのステータスに基づいて在庫の在庫が物理的に更新されます。 出荷注文経由で在庫を出荷すると、ピッキング後の最新の に基づいて物理的な 在庫が減らされます。 関連する出荷受領書と出荷梱包明細仕訳帳が、バックグラウンドの最終処理プロセスの一部として転記されるまで、登録およびピッキングした品目の現物手持在庫表示は維持されます。 現物手持在庫のこの部分をエクスポートに含めるには、登録済みおよびピッキング済の在庫数量を含めるパラメーターを有効 にしてください。
外部システムには、ビジネス イベントを通じて取得できるデータ WHSSourceSystemInventoryOnhandReportBusinessEvent
通知されます。 WarehouseInventoryOnhandReports
および WarehouseInventoryOnhandReportLines
データ エンティティを介してデータを読み取ることができます。
メモ
ソース システムの手持在庫の作成 レポートを定期的なバッチ ジョブとして実行すると、現在の日付 値は無視され、データは現在の処理日付に基づいて生成されます。 たとえば、開始日 の値が昨日になるように繰り返しを設定し、ジョブが 1 日に 1 回実行されるように設定します。 この場合、バッチ ジョブは毎日、前日の手持在庫データを自動的に生成します。
倉庫在庫更新ログ
非常に迅速な在庫同期プロセスを必要とする統合については、倉庫在庫更新ログ (在庫更新ログ>Inquiriesおよびレポート>物理在庫調整>在庫更新ログ) を使用できます。 このログは、外部システムに重要な手持在庫の更新につながるすべての在庫トランザクション更新を収集できます。 たとえば、在庫状態の変更に関する情報を処理する外部システムがあるとします。
出荷注文の受信と出荷に関連する在庫トランザクションの更新に関する外部システムの更新を維持するには、 有効な倉庫在庫更新ログ オプション ソース システム 関連する ソース システム を、受信と出荷の両方の出荷注文に対して設定します。
更新ログを表示するには、次に移動します 在庫更新ログ>在庫更新ログ>物理在庫調整>在庫更新ログ。
重要
倉庫在庫更新ログを有効化するオプションを有効化すると、出荷受領書や出荷梱包明細メッセージの一部として使用されるデータと組み合わせて二重更新が発生しないように、外部システムで更新を必ず取り込みます。
既定では、倉庫在庫更新ログの更新の公開 バックグラウンド プロセスは、10 分ごとに実行されるように設定されています。 WarehouseInventoryUpdateLogs
エンティティを使用して、外部システムが使用できるデータを作成します。 WHSInventoryUpdateLogBusinessEvent
ビジネス イベントは、このプロセスの一部として使用できます。